Hankinson is a city located in Richland County, North Dakota. Hankinson has a 2025 population of 918. Hankinson is currently declining at a rate of 0% annually and its population has decreased by 0%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 918 in 2020.

The average household income in Hankinson is $71,890 with a poverty rate of 10.79%.The median age in Hankinson is 45.4 years: 45 years for males, and 45.7 years for females.

Economics and Income Statistics

Hankinson's average per capita income is $40,673. Household income levels show a median of $66,250. The poverty rate stands at 10.79%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
